Show Notes

Big spends on the Mt Messenger bypass roading project, despite no road actually being built.

The Transport Agency has already spent 60 percent of the $280 million dollar budget of the Taranaki project.

New Plymouth Mayor Neil Holdom says there's no way the project will get done within the projected budget.

He blames frivolous court cases for the hold up, and says it is time to get on with the job.

"Yep, it's going to be expensive, but I can assure you that if we didn't build it and the mountain slipped down, it would be a hell of a lot more expensive for NZ inc."

NZTA have confirmed they will be conducting a cost review, which is set to be completed in the first half of 2024.
